What is Rewilding?
Rewilding is a conservation strategy that focuses on restoring ecosystems to their natural state by reintroducing native species, especially keystone species, and allowing nature to manage itself without further human intervention. The ultimate goal of rewilding is to revive ecosystems by fostering biodiversity, which helps improve ecosystem resilience and functionality. Unlike traditional conservation efforts that focus on protecting individual species, rewilding takes a holistic approach to ecosystem restoration, aiming to re-establish natural processes such as predation, migration, and seed dispersal.
The philosophy behind rewilding is rooted in the belief that ecosystems are self-regulating, provided that the necessary components—such as predators, herbivores, and plant species—are present. When human interference is minimized, ecosystems can often heal themselves, creating environments that support a wide range of flora and fauna.
The Role of Rewilding in the African Savannah
The African Savannah, one of the most iconic landscapes on the planet, is home to a diverse array of species, including elephants, lions, giraffes, zebras, and countless other forms of wildlife. However, human activities such as agriculture, deforestation, and poaching have disrupted the natural balance, leading to a dramatic decline in biodiversity.
Rewilding offers a promising solution for reversing biodiversity loss in the African Savannah by restoring the ecological functions that have been lost. One of the primary ways rewilding is applied in the Savannah is through the reintroduction of keystone species—animals that have a disproportionately large impact on their environment relative to their abundance. For example, the reintroduction of large herbivores like elephants can help control vegetation growth and maintain the structure of the Savannah, while the presence of apex predators like lions can regulate herbivore populations, preventing overgrazing.
Key Species in Rewilding the Savannah
Several key species play a critical role in rewilding efforts in the African Savannah, each contributing to ecosystem restoration in unique ways. Below are some examples of how specific species support biodiversity and ecosystem health:
- Elephants: Often referred to as “ecosystem engineers,” elephants play a crucial role in shaping the Savannah landscape. By uprooting trees, breaking branches, and trampling vegetation, they help create a mosaic of different habitats, which benefits a wide range of other species. Elephants also contribute to seed dispersal, facilitating the growth of new plants and trees.
- Lions and Other Apex Predators: As top predators, lions help control populations of herbivores such as zebras and antelopes. By keeping these populations in check, lions prevent overgrazing and help maintain a balance between herbivores and vegetation. The absence of apex predators can lead to an overpopulation of herbivores, which can degrade the ecosystem.
- Giraffes: Giraffes play a unique role in rewilding by browsing on trees and shrubs, which helps control the spread of woody vegetation. Their feeding habits prevent bush encroachment, which can otherwise turn open Savannah grasslands into dense thickets, making the habitat unsuitable for many species.
- Rhinos: Rhinos are vital for maintaining the diversity of plant life in the Savannah. They graze on grasses, helping to promote new growth and maintaining open grasslands. This, in turn, supports a variety of herbivores that rely on these grasslands for food.
The Impact of Rewilding on Ecosystem Processes
Rewilding not only restores individual species but also helps reinstate the complex web of interactions between plants, animals, and the physical environment. By reintroducing species that have been lost or diminished, rewilding can help revive natural processes such as:
- Predation: The return of apex predators reintroduces natural predation dynamics, which are essential for maintaining balanced herbivore populations. This prevents overgrazing and ensures that vegetation remains healthy and diverse.
- Seed Dispersal: Many species, such as elephants and birds, play a critical role in dispersing seeds across large areas. This process promotes plant diversity and helps restore habitats that have been degraded by human activities.
- Water Regulation: Rewilding can also improve water systems by restoring vegetation that helps maintain natural water cycles. Trees and plants prevent soil erosion and help regulate water flow, reducing the risk of floods and droughts.
Benefits of Rewilding for Biodiversity
One of the most significant benefits of rewilding is its potential to enhance biodiversity. By restoring key species and allowing natural processes to unfold, rewilding creates habitats that support a wide variety of life forms. Increased biodiversity leads to more resilient ecosystems, which are better able to withstand environmental stresses such as climate change, disease outbreaks, and habitat destruction.
In the African Savannah, rewilding can help restore populations of endangered species, rebuild food webs, and create habitats that are more conducive to wildlife. For example, the reintroduction of herbivores like rhinos and antelopes can increase plant diversity, while predators such as lions and leopards help regulate prey populations. This creates a balanced ecosystem where different species are able to thrive.
Challenges of Rewilding in the Savannah
Despite its potential, rewilding in the African Savannah is not without challenges. Human-wildlife conflict, especially in areas where local communities rely on agriculture or livestock, can pose significant obstacles to rewilding efforts. Additionally, poaching remains a serious threat to species reintroduction programs, particularly for animals like rhinos and elephants that are targeted for their horns and tusks.
To address these challenges, successful rewilding initiatives must involve local communities, ensuring that conservation efforts align with the needs and livelihoods of people who live in and around rewilding areas. Education, anti-poaching measures, and compensation schemes for farmers who lose livestock to predators are essential components of a comprehensive rewilding strategy.
